From: Matthieu Date: Sat, 31 Dec 2022 13:48:52 +0000 (+0400) Subject: Update docker-publish.yml X-Git-Tag: v0.1~34^2 X-Git-Url: https://git.puffer.fish/?a=commitdiff_plain;h=4df29cc000311e7022062c966a1d618bf920cfc5;p=matthieu%2Fnova.git Update docker-publish.yml --- diff --git a/.github/workflows/docker-publish.yml b/.github/workflows/docker-publish.yml index 5047c29..ea7f567 100644 --- a/.github/workflows/docker-publish.yml +++ b/.github/workflows/docker-publish.yml @@ -4,7 +4,10 @@ on: push: branches: - 'main' - +env: + # Use docker.io for Docker Hub if empty + REGISTRY: ghcr.io + jobs: bake: runs-on: ubuntu-latest @@ -15,12 +18,13 @@ jobs: - name: Set up Docker Buildx uses: docker/setup-buildx-action@v2 - - - name: Login to DockerHub - uses: docker/login-action@v2 + + - name: Log into registry ${{ env.REGISTRY }} + uses: docker/login-action@28218f9b04b4f3f62068d7b6ce6ca5b26e35336c with: - username: ${{ secrets.DOCKERHUB_USERNAME }} - password: ${{ secrets.DOCKERHUB_TOKEN }} + registry: ${{ env.REGISTRY }} + username: ${{ github.actor }} + password: ${{ secrets.GITHUB_TOKEN }} - name: Build and push uses: docker/bake-action@v2